Definitions:

Rule of Reason

A legal doctrine that judges the legality of business practices based on their context and effect on competition, rather than deeming them illegal per se.

Joint Ventures

Collaborative agreements in which multiple parties decide to combine their assets to achieve a particular goal or project.

Leegin Creative Leather Products

A notable Supreme Court case that addressed the legality of price fixing and established guidelines for vertical price agreements.

Minimum Resale Prices

Agreements or policies that set the lowest price at which a product may be resold, often used by manufacturers to maintain brand image or stabilize market price.
